  1. What Fluid Would Get On The Upper Timing Cover?

    If it is on the inside of the top timing belt cover it is very likely engine oil getting past a can seal. That is my best guess.If it is on the outside it is likely power steering fluid if you still have power steering.

  3. Car Overheated / Overheating / Overheats [MERGED]

    That is 100% not the cause of your overheating.Common reasons for DSMs to overheat: Bad radiator cap Bad thermostat Clogged radiator Fans not working properly or not kicking on Water pump failing Low on coolant or huge air bubble Fmic blocking air flow to radiator Blown head gasket Heater core...
